At Flowers Hornchurch, we recognise our responsibility to uphold human rights and ensure that modern slavery and human trafficking have no place in our business or supply chains. As a trusted local florist serving the homes and businesses of Hornchurch, we are committed to conducting our operations ethically and transparently, with care for our community and stakeholders.
We maintain a strict zero tolerance approach to modern slavery and human trafficking across all areas of our business. This commitment includes our own employees as well as anyone involved in our supply chain. We stand firmly against any practices that exploit vulnerable individuals, including forced labour, servitude, or child labour. All members of our team are expected to share these values and uphold our standards in their daily work, both internally and when representing Flowers Hornchurch among suppliers and clients.
As a business that relies on a diverse network of suppliers, we undertake thorough due diligence in the selection and ongoing evaluation of our partners and vendors. Wherever possible, we source products from established growers, wholesalers, and distributors that adhere to fair labour practices and relevant legislation. Our contracts with suppliers include clear terms concerning compliance with modern slavery laws. We will disengage with, or take appropriate action against, any supplier failing to meet our ethical expectations.
We equip our team, both new hires and existing employees, with training that highlights the risks of modern slavery and guides them on identifying warning signs in day-to-day operations or supplier interactions. This ongoing education reinforces our values and supports a culture of vigilance. Through discussion and practical examples, our staff learn to recognise potentially exploitative situations and understand their responsibility to act upon any concerns.
We provide accessible and confidential channels for staff to report suspicions or evidence of modern slavery. All reports are treated with seriousness and sensitivity. Anyone who raises a concern in good faith is protected from victimisation or retaliation. Our management team promptly investigates all allegations and, where necessary, involves the appropriate authorities to ensure the safety and wellbeing of affected individuals. We are committed to remedying any breach in our standards without delay.
Our modern slavery statement is reviewed annually, or more frequently if required by legislative changes or identified risks. During these reviews, we assess the effectiveness of our policies, supplier management, training, and reporting mechanisms. This process ensures our approach remains robust, up-to-date, and responsive to evolving standards and threats. Any necessary amendments are communicated to our staff and suppliers with clarity and urgency.
